The slope of a velocity vs. time graph is a measure of acceleration. If the velocity graph is approximately a straight line of constant slope, the ... WebAndrew M. 5 years ago. What the area "is" depends on what the graph is. If the graph is velocity vs time, then finding the area will give you displacement, because velocity = displacement / time. If the graph is acceleration vs time, then finding the area gives you change in velocity, because acceleration = change in velocity / time. green hills mall nashville tn hours

Let upward be the positive direction and let the … WebCompare the change-in-velocity vector for each of the two time intervals. You will find that they are the same. Since the acceleration is constant, the change in velocity is constant for any given time interval. The area under a v x vs. time graph is always the displacement, Δx. You can use the graph to find Δx from t = 0 to t = 3 s.

WebThe area under a velocity graph represents the displacement of the object. To see why, consider the following graph of motion that shows an object maintaining a constant velocity of 6 meters per second for a time of 5 seconds.
